Introduction
Authentication
Error Definitions
Rate Limits
Testing Zoom APIs
Accounts
Billing
Users
Roles
Meetings
Webinars
Groups
IM Groups
IM Chat
Cloud Recording
Reports
Dashboards
Webhooks
TSP
PAC
Devices
TrackingField
Phone
Models
Webhook Reference
Account Events
App Events
Meeting Events
Recording Events
User Events
Webinar Events
Zoom Room Events
Data Compliance

Zoom API Version 2 provides a set of Master Account APIs. These APIs allow a Master Account to manage Sub Accounts utilizing the Master Account’s API Key/Secret. Previously you would have to know the Sub Account’s API Key/Secret to mange it’s users and meetings. The endpoints mirror the standard Zoom API, pre-pended with /accounts/{accountID}

User APIs

Method Endpoint
GET /v2/accounts/{accountId}/users List all the users on Zoom.
POST /v2/accounts/{accountId}/users Create a user on Zoom.
GET /v2/accounts/{accountId}/users/{userId} Get a user on Zoom via user ID or user email.
PATCH /v2/accounts/{accountId}/users/{userId} Update user’s info on Zoom via user ID.
DELETE /v2/accounts/{accountId}/users/{userId} Delete a user on Zoom.
GET /v2/accounts/{accountId}/users/{userId}/settings Get a user on Zoom via user ID or user email, return the user settings.
PATCH /v2/accounts/{accountId}/users/{userId}/settings Update user’s settings on Zoom via user ID.
PUT /v2/accounts/{accountId}/users/{userId}/status Update user’s status on Zoom via user ID.
PUT /v2/accounts/{accountId}/users/{userId}/password Update user’s password on Zoom via user ID.
GET /v2/accounts/{accountId}/users/{userId}/assistants List user’s assistants on Zoom via user ID.
POST /v2/accounts/{accountId}/users/{userId}/assistants Add user’s assistants on Zoom via user ID.
DELETE /v2/accounts/{accountId}/users/{userId}/assistants Delete all the user’s assistants on Zoom via user ID.
DELETE /v2/accounts/{accountId}/users/{userId}/assistants/{assistantId} Delete a user’s assistant on Zoom via user ID.
POST /v2/accounts/{accountId}/users/{userId}/picture Upload a user’s profile picture on Zoom via user ID.
GET /v2/accounts/{accountId}/users/{userId}/token Get a user’s token on Zoom via user ID.
DELETE /v2/accounts/{accountId}/users/{userId}/token Revoke a user’s SSO token.